Confirm your role qualifies as a specialty occupation
USCIS requires H-1B roles to need at least a bachelor's degree in a specific field. Marketing roles at consulting firms typically qualify when tied to technical sectors, but your offer letter should reflect that degree-level expertise explicitly.
Use DOL's LCA disclosure data to validate sponsorship intent
Before applying, search the DOL's OFLC disclosure database for WSP's Labor Condition Application filings in Marketing job titles. Seeing approved LCAs for similar roles in your target region confirms active sponsorship activity for this function.

Which visa types does WSP commonly use for Marketing roles?
WSP sponsors H-1B and E-3 visas for temporary work authorization, along with F-1 OPT and CPT for students and recent graduates transitioning into full-time roles. For candidates pursuing permanent residency, WSP also supports EB-2 and EB-3 Green Card pathways and accepts TN visa holders from Canada and Mexico in eligible roles.

How long does the visa sponsorship process take when joining WSP?
For H-1B cap-subject candidates, count on a minimum of several months between offer acceptance and your start date, since petitions open in March and employment begins October 1 at the earliest. E-3 and TN visas process faster, often within weeks of a consular appointment. PERM-based Green Card sponsorship, if offered, typically begins after your first year of employment and can take two or more years to complete.
